Ekta Singh is a scholar working on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Building and Construction and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Ekta Singh has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 960 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, 3 papers in Building and Construction and 3 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Ekta Singh's work include Transportation Planning and Optimization (2 papers), Recycling and Waste Management Techniques (2 papers) and Urban Transport and Accessibility (2 papers). Ekta Singh is often cited by papers focused on Transportation Planning and Optimization (2 papers), Recycling and Waste Management Techniques (2 papers) and Urban Transport and Accessibility (2 papers). Ekta Singh collaborates with scholars based in India, United States and Germany. Ekta Singh's co-authors include Sunil Kumar, Aman Kumar, Rahul Mishra, Aman Kumar, Balasubramani Ravindran, Tao Liu, Surendra Sarsaiya, Zengqiang Zhang, Yumin Duan and Steven Wainaina and has published in prestigious journals such as The Science of The Total Environment, Bioresource Technology and Chemosphere.
